The voice lines in *WarioWare: Move It!* aren't just there for comedic effect; they also play a crucial role in enhancing the overall gameplay experience. First and foremost, they provide **clear and concise instructions** for the microgames. While the commands may be delivered in a silly or exaggerated way, they still serve the important function of telling you what to do. This is especially important in a game like *WarioWare*, where you have to react quickly to a series of rapid-fire challenges. The voice lines cut through the chaos and provide you with the information you need to succeed. In addition to providing instructions, the voice lines also **add to the sense of urgency and excitement**. The characters shout and exclaim, creating a sense of heightened tension that keeps you on the edge of your seat. The voice lines help to amp up the pressure, making the game even more thrilling. The voice lines also **create a sense of immersion**. By hearing the characters speak, you feel more connected to the game world and the characters within it. This is especially true for long-time fans of the series, who have come to know and love the voices of Wario and his friends. Hearing their familiar pronouncements makes the game feel like a homecoming, adding to the overall sense of enjoyment. Finally, the voice lines **provide a sense of feedback**. When you succeed in a microgame, the characters will often cheer and congratulate you, providing positive reinforcement that encourages you to keep playing. This is a subtle but important element of the game's design, helping to keep you motivated and engaged.
